Effect of Filament Power Removal on a Fluorescent Lamp System

摘要

Two techniques are used to measure the effects of removing the filament power from a two-lamp, F-40, rapid-start fluorescent lamp system. The changes are measured for a standard CBM core-coil ballast and for a solid-state ballast operating the lamp at high frequency. There is a 4 tp 6% increase in system efficacy when the filament power is removed. Removal of filament power also decreases filament temperature from 1000 exp 0 C to below 700 exp 0 C in lamps operated at 60 Hz, and from above 600 exp 0 C to 300 exp 0 C in lamps operated at high frequency. The study shows that the arc current and anode fall also determine filament temperature. (ERA citation 10:046663)
